Phil Hodge. Phil joined Pine Cliff Energy as the Company’s first employee in January 2012 as President, Chief Executive Officer, and Director. Mr. Hodge most recently held the positions of Vice President, Business Development and Vice President Acquisitions and Divestments at Penn West Exploration, one of the largest conventional oil and natural gas producers in North America. Prior to that, Mr. Hodge was a Managing Director at Mackie Research Capital Corporation and J.F. Mackie & Co., Calgary based investment banks. From 2000 to 2006, Mr. Hodge was Vice President and General Counsel of Westport Innovations Inc. where he was responsible for legal, corporate governance, strategic partnership and corporate development functions, as well as the formation and growth of the company’s business in China. Prior to 2000, Mr. Hodge was a partner at Bennett Jones LLP, a Canadian national law firm, practicing in that firm’s securities and mergers and acquisitions teams in its Calgary office.
